This is a bad company with some good people. If you do well being micromanged, having your phone calls listened to and counted, this would be a fine place for you. The concept is ideal - work from home, help people find senior care. The reality is that morale is low, there is no type of motivation except being told you are not doing enough even when you are making your goals and quotas. And to top it off, you are harassing people more than you are helping. You can only close a lead if someone has DIED. Imagine how awkward it is to call someone who inquired online six months ago to be told they no longer need your services because Mom passed away. If you feel you can handle a draw position that is essentially 100% commission, but you are treated as if the company owns you body and soul, then go for it.
